Wednesday 9 February 2011

Some sunny intervals were interspersed amongst the heavy drizzle and a fresh south-easterly winds that persisted throughout most of the day. Another quite day bird-wise saw very little about. Good numbers of waders were present at high tide however nothing different was amongst them. Fourteen Mallards and five Shelducks were the only ducks around and the first Rock Pipit began singing quietly in its rather strange position under Solfach hide!

 A Curlew flock continues to feed in the fields just inland of the coast.
